Fiber-Filled Champions: Fruits

Fruits such as berries, apples, and pears are packed with fiber, promoting steady digestion and stable blood sugar levels. Despite common misconceptions, fruit can and should be a part of a diabetic-friendly diet, offering both nourishment and enjoyment.

Green Guardians: Leafy Greens

Leafy greens like spinach and kale are nutritional powerhouses that support stable blood sugar levels. These “guardians” offer essential nutrients like alpha-lipoic acid and thiamin, which are vital for anyone managing diabetes.

Lean Proteins: Your Trusty Sidekicks

Proteins from sources like chicken, tofu, and lentils help prevent blood sugar spikes and keep hunger at bay. They are essential for maintaining muscle mass and metabolic health, providing both satiety and strength without unnecessary calories.
